Hey all, Newby here...been lurking for a while and finding most things in the search. I have a new issue. My car is a 98 GS Spyder, auto trans. The car is bone stock except for Torque 5 rims. I have a noise/vibration coming from the front left. It sounds/feels like when you have a flat spot on a tire. It only happens when I release the gas pedal. It goes away when I accelerate or if I slip the trans in neutral. Does anyone have any experience with anything like that? Thanks.

129337, RE: Intermittent thumping noise--front left wheel/axle Posted by ez, Jan-19-10 11:11 AM
This can happen with worn motor mounts. It can even happen with normal motor mounts, because that front MM has a bolt that is smaller in diameter than the hole it goes through.

129347, RE: Intermittent thumping noise--front left wheel/axle Posted by gasha1, Jan-20-10 05:11 AM
OK...on the way home from work last night the problem got worse. It now occurs on and off the gas and in neutral. It does not change with the steering angle and does not change with breaking.
|
129348, RE: Intermittent thumping noise--front left wheel/axle Posted by biggie16g, Jan-20-10 10:13 AM
Jack up your car and shake the wheel side to side, and up and down. See if you notice any looseness in the ball joints, and tie rod ends. if not crawl up under your car and check the cv shaft. Push and pull see if it has and clunking noise. Let us know what you find.
|
129427, RE: Intermittent thumping noise--front left wheel/axle Posted by gasha1, Jan-24-10 08:02 AM
...problem solved. It turns out the garage that did my front-end alignment and tire rotation didn't torque my left fron wheel properly. After the lugs were tightened the problem went away. There were three other lugs on the other wheels that were barely finger tight.
